The History of HIPAA

Few people know that the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act, or HIPAA, has been around for over two decades. The law was enacted in 1996 as a response to the rapidly changing health insurance landscape. At the time, employers were increasingly dropping health coverage for their employees, and people with pre-existing conditions were having a hard time finding new coverage. HIPAA was designed to protect workers and their families from being denied coverage due to a change in employment status.

Over the years, HIPAA has evolved to encompass a much broader range of issues. The most recent update to the law, known as the HITECH Act, was passed in 2009 in response to the increasing use of electronic health records. The HITECH Act made several changes to HIPAA, including stiffer penalties for non-compliance and the creation of new privacy and security rules.

Today, HIPAA is one of the most important laws governing the healthcare industry. Compliance with HIPAA is essential for any organization that deals with protected health information (PHI). The penalties for non-compliance can be severe, so it’s important to make sure you have a solid understanding of the law and how it applies to your business.

The Different Parts of HIPAA

When it comes to HIPAA compliance, there are a lot of different moving parts. From technical safeguards to administrative processes, it can be difficult to keep everything straight. We willl break down the different aspects of HIPAA compliance so you can get a better understanding of what’s involved.

Technical Safeguards: These are the security measures put in place to protect electronic health information. This includes things like encryption, firewalls, and access controls.

Administrative Processes: These are the policies and procedures that need to be in place in order for an organization to be compliant. This includes things like risk assessments, employee training, and incident response plans.

Physical Safeguards: These are the security measures put in place to protect physical health information. This includes things like locked cabinets, security cameras, and visitor logs.
